Sayfayı Yazdır | Pencereyi Kapat

Clomosy Son Sürüm Do-While Hatası

Nereden Yazdırıldığı: Clomosy | Forum
Kategori: Genel Programlama
Forum Adı: Genel İşlemler
Forum Tanımlaması: TRObject dili ile programlama yaparken karşılaşılan genel işlemler
URL: https://forum.clomosy.com.tr/forum_posts.asp?TID=772
Tarih: 08 Ocak 2025 Saat 20:33
Program Versiyonu: Web Wiz Forums 12.07 - https://www.webwizforums.com


Konu: Clomosy Son Sürüm Do-While Hatası
Mesajı Yazan: goktugrlr
Konu: Clomosy Son Sürüm Do-While Hatası
Mesaj Tarihi: 30 Temmuz 2024 Saat 18:01
Merhabalar,
Clomosy'nin en son sürümünde (Debug Form'lu olan) aşağıdaki do while döngüsünde syntax hatası vermekte. Bir önceki sürümde aynı kodu çalıştırınca sorunsuz bir şekilde çalışıyor.
Hata verdiği satır do ifadesinin olduğu satır.

void CustBuyPropose;
var
randomIndex : Integer;
{
  buyPanel.Visible = not buyPanel.Visible;

  do
   {
     randomIndex = clMath.GenerateRandom(0, onSaleItemsID.Count); 
   }
   while (onSaleItemsID.GetItem(randomIndex) == 0);
   
   InspectItem(onSaleItemsID.GetItem(randomIndex));
   ShowMessage('I want to buy ' + tempName);
}

Teşekkürler.



Cevaplar:
Mesajı Yazan: oguz22
Mesaj Tarihi: 30 Temmuz 2024 Saat 18:08
Merhaba bu şekilde kullanabilirsiniz

var
 num, sqrNum  : Integer;

{
 num= 1;
 sqrNum  = num* num;

 Repeat
   ShowMessage(IntToStr(num)+' Karesi = '+IntToStr(sqrNum));

   Inc(num);

   sqrNum = num * num;
 until sqrNum > 100;
}



Sayfayı Yazdır | Pencereyi Kapat

Forum Software by Web Wiz Forums® version 12.07 - https://www.webwizforums.com
Copyright ©2001-2024 Web Wiz Ltd. - https://www.webwiz.net